WASHINGTON: US special operations forces last month boarded a vessel traveling from China to Iran in the Indian Ocean and seized military-related items, the Wall Street Journal reported on Friday, citing US officials. According to the report, the cargo included components that could have been used in Iranâs conventional weapons programs. A US official said the seized materials were later destroyed.
The operation took place in November, several hundred miles off Sri Lankaâs coast. After the raid, the vessel was permitted to continue its journey. The action occurred weeks before US forces seized an oil tanker off Venezuelaâs coast for alleged sanctions violations.
US President Donald Trump, who has been intensifying pressure on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ro, said earlier this week that the United States had intercepted a âvery largeâ tanker near Venezuela, adding that âother things are happening.â US officials said special operations forces carried out the raid. Iran and China did not immediately comment on the report.
